Miranda Holds Annual Retreat
Miranda held its Annual Retreat on 1st March. The event brought together lawyers and staff for a friendly gathering in order to reflect on the past year and to plan for the current year. The Minister of State and Foreign Affairs, Mr. Luís Amado, was the guest speaker at the event.
According to Managing Partner Rui Amendoeira “2007, the year in which we celebrated two decades of existence, was very positive for our Firm. We expanded our international presence to East Timor, opened an office in Madeira, substantially increased our number of attorneys, created a Human Resources Department, and we were named, in conjunction with our associate offices, 'African Law Firm of the Year' for the second consecutive year. These accomplishments are more than adequate reasons for the Firm to be satisfied with what we have achieved. We believe that the results for 2008 will make us very proud as well”. Miranda´s Managing Partner remarked “On a day of reflection, contemplation and social interaction, it was an honour for us to welcome the presence of Mr. Luís Amado, Minister of State and Foreign Affairs. His explanation of the primary issues that affect Portuguese and European foreign policy was simply remarkable and resulted in an excellent experience for all in attendance”.
The retreat took place at Ribeiro Telles Plaza, in Vila Franca de Xira. The morning session consisted of multiple presentations that mapped out the Firm’s objectives for 2008. Lunch and “Team Building” activities, which filled up the afternoon, took place in the Equestrian Centre of Lezíria Grande, in a fun and relaxing atmosphere.
Rui Amendoeira summed up by stating “One of the primary concerns of this Board of Directors is to have all the members of the Firm committed with the issues that have an impact on the day-to-day affairs of the Firm. We consider essential for everyone to be in line with our values and, in this sense, it is extremely important to promote events of this nature to debate the future of our organisation”.
